共用方式為


Job interface

作業。

Extends

屬性

backupPointInTime

用於故障轉移的備份時間。

backupType

備份類型 (CloudSnapshot |LocalSnapshot)。 僅適用於備份作業。

dataStats

作業的數據統計數據屬性。

deviceId

執行作業的裝置識別碼。

endTime

作業完成的UTC時間。

entityLabel

執行作業的實體標識碼。

entityType

執行作業的實體類型。

error

作業的錯誤詳細數據,如果有的話。

isCancellable

表示作業是否可取消。

jobStages

作業階段。

jobType

作業的類型。

percentComplete

已完成之作業的百分比。

sourceDeviceId

故障轉移作業的來源裝置標識碼。

startTime

啟動作業的 UTC 時間。

status

作業的目前狀態。

繼承的屬性

id

可唯一識別對象的路徑識別碼。 注意:這個屬性不會串行化。 它只能由伺服器填入。

kind

物件的Kind。 目前僅支援 Series8000

name

物件的名稱。 注意:這個屬性不會串行化。 它只能由伺服器填入。

type

對象的階層式類型。 注意:這個屬性不會串行化。 它只能由伺服器填入。

屬性詳細資料

backupPointInTime

用於故障轉移的備份時間。

backupPointInTime?: Date

屬性值

Date

backupType

備份類型 (CloudSnapshot |LocalSnapshot)。 僅適用於備份作業。

backupType?: BackupType

屬性值

dataStats

作業的數據統計數據屬性。

dataStats?: DataStatistics

屬性值

deviceId

執行作業的裝置識別碼。

deviceId?: string

屬性值

string

endTime

作業完成的UTC時間。

endTime?: Date

屬性值

Date

entityLabel

執行作業的實體標識碼。

entityLabel?: string

屬性值

string

entityType

執行作業的實體類型。

entityType?: string

屬性值

string

error

作業的錯誤詳細數據,如果有的話。

error?: JobErrorDetails

屬性值

isCancellable

表示作業是否可取消。

isCancellable?: boolean

屬性值

boolean

jobStages

作業階段。

jobStages?: JobStage[]

屬性值

jobType

作業的類型。

jobType?: JobType

屬性值

percentComplete

已完成之作業的百分比。

percentComplete: number

屬性值

number

sourceDeviceId

故障轉移作業的來源裝置標識碼。

sourceDeviceId?: string

屬性值

string

startTime

啟動作業的 UTC 時間。

startTime?: Date

屬性值

Date

status

作業的目前狀態。

status: JobStatus

屬性值

繼承的屬性詳細資料

id

可唯一識別對象的路徑識別碼。 注意:這個屬性不會串行化。 它只能由伺服器填入。

id?: string

屬性值

string

繼承自BaseModel.id

kind

物件的Kind。 目前僅支援 Series8000

kind?: "Series8000"

屬性值

"Series8000"

繼承自BaseModel.kind

name

物件的名稱。 注意:這個屬性不會串行化。 它只能由伺服器填入。

name?: string

屬性值

string

繼承自BaseModel.name

type

對象的階層式類型。 注意:這個屬性不會串行化。 它只能由伺服器填入。

type?: string

屬性值

string

繼承自BaseModel.type